Ecological analysis of helminths in vendace and smelt from lake Onego
Лариса Васильевна Аникиева, Евгений Павлович Иешко, Евгений Алексеевич Румянцев, Larisa Anikieva, Evegny Ieshko, Evgeny Rumyantsev

Abstract

The parasite fauna of LakeOnegocommercial fish species – vendace, Coregonus albula L., and smelt, Osmerus eperlanus L., was studied. The prevalence, abundance distribution and age structure of the cestode Proteocephalus longicollis (Zeder, 1800) in vendace were determined. Seasonal variations of Eubothrium crassum (Bloch, 1779) infection in vendace were traced, and the role of vendace in the life cycle of this cestode was identified. A comparative analysis of long-term changes in the parasite fauna of vendace and smelt was carried out. The species diversity of helminths and its structure proved to be relatively stable. Changes were mainly observed in the intensity of infection. These results suggest that the two major plankton-feeders, vendace and smelt, quite successfully coinhabitLakeOnego.
